Eine eigene Website – ohne Wartungsaufwand

Ich finde es eine gute, hilfreiche und sinnvolle Sache, wenn Menschen, die kluge Gedanken haben, diese nicht nur für sich behalten und sie auch nicht nur über Social Media Plattformen publizieren, wo sie nicht nachhaltig auffindbar sind, keine Hoheit darüber besteht und sie vor allem auch sehr schlecht referenziert werden können. Stattdessen rege ich in solchen Fällen sehr gerne und häufig an, sich doch eine eigene Website einzurichten.

Mein Standard-Vorschlag hierzu war eine WordPress-Website. Wenn es die eigene Website ist, dann nutzt man hier nicht WordPress.com, sondern lädt sich über wordpress.org die Open Source Software herunter und installiert sie auch auf einen Server. Ich habe das Vorgehen in diesem Beitrag ausführlich beschrieben. Der große Vorteil an WordPress ist, dass die Software direkt viele hilfreiche Funktionalitäten mitbringt. Im Blog können z.B. direkt Kommentare freigeschaltet werden. Außerdem lassen sich über WordPress unter anderem Formulare anlegen oder auch H5P-Inhalte erstellen und teilen. So etwas kann im pädagogischen Alltag sehr hilfreich sein.

In letzter Zeit habe ich nun aber immer öfter die Erfahrung gemacht, dass WordPress für viele Menschen auch keine sinnvolle Wahl ist. Insbesondere dann, wenn Menschen sehr eingespannt sind, wahrscheinlich eher weniger bloggen, sondern einfach nur immer mal wieder etwas online stellen wollen, aber ansonsten mit der Website möglichst wenig zu tun haben wollen. In diesem Fall ist WordPress eine schlechte Wahl, weil es schon nötig ist, dort regelmäßig drauf zu schauen, Updates zu installieren und die Seite (gerade wenn man Kommentare oder andere interaktive Möglichkeiten nutzt) im Blick zu behalten.

Auf eine eigene Website muss dann trotzdem nicht verzichtet werden, aber ich würde dann nicht WordPress, sondern besser ein statisches Website-Tool empfehlen. Am liebsten mag ich hier gerade Publii, weil es grundsätzlich sehr benutzerfreundlich und nicht zu nerdig angelegt ist, so dass auch technisch nicht sehr affine Menschen damit zurecht kommen sollten.

Beim Einrichten solcher Websites kommt man schnell zu einer gewissen Routine und übersieht, dass beim ersten Mal doch mehr getan werden muss, als es sich für mich inzwischen anfühlt. Um die erstmalige Erstellung einer solchen Website für dich so einfach wie möglich zu machen, kommen hier die Schritte, die du nacheinander durchgehen kannst – inklusive einer offen nutzbaren Vorlage, um direkt ohne langes Einrichten mit der inhaltlichen Arbeit beginnen zu können:

1. Domain und Webspace kaufen

Für einen eigenen Ort im Netz benötigst du Webspace und eine Domain (= der Name, über den andere deine Website aufrufen können). Ich empfehle dazu, sich einen Account bei Hetzner anzulegen, dann das Webhosting Paket S auszuwählen, dort einen Namen festzulegen und die Domain einzugeben. Weitere Angaben braucht es nicht. Wenn die Domain noch frei ist, kann sie direkt bestellt werden. Jetzt braucht es 1-2 Stunden bis der Account und die Domain nutzbar sind. Du kannst in dieser Zeit direkt mit den nächsten Schritten weitermachen.

2. Publii installieren

Wir wollen die Website ja mit Publii bauen. Das ist ein Programm, über das du dann Inhalte für die Website schreiben kannst und von dort aus dann auch direkt auf den Webspace hochladen kannst. Damit du dieses Programm nutzen kannst, musst du es dir auf deinem Desktop-Gerät installieren. Du lädst es dir dazu von hier herunter passend zu deinem Betriebssystem und lässt dich durch den Installationsprozess führen. Dann kannst du das Programm öffnen.

3. Website in Publii anlegen

In Publii kommt dann jetzt der interessantere Part. Du kannst dir dort deine gewünschte Website anlegen. Um dir die ersten Schritte möglichst einfach zu machen, empfehle ich dir, deine Website nicht neu, sondern von einem Backup anlegen. Dazu lädst du dir hier diese Datei herunter und dann bei Publii rein.

start-fuer-deine-websiteHerunterladen

Also: ‚Create new Website‘ und dann ‚Install from Backup‘. Dann kannst du direkt den gewünschten Seitennamen angeben und mit einem bereits fertigen Rohgerüst starten. Du musst dann diese Schritte gehen:

  • Unter Site Settings deine Beschreibung eingeben.
  • Unter Author deinen Namen eintrage
  • Unter Theme unten bei Layout runterscrollen bis du zur Hero-Section kommst. Dort dann deinen Begrüßungstext eingeben. Unter Footer kannst du Accounts von Social Media eintragen.
  • Unter Pages bei Impressum und Datenschutz deine Kontaktangaben eingeben

Danach kannst du zu Posts gehen und deinen ersten Beitrag schreiben.

Nützlich ist noch der File-Manager, wenn du z.B. eine Präsentation oder eine andere Datei hochladen und dann in Posts oder Pages verlinken kannst. Du findest den File Manager unter Tools & Plugins.

4. Mail und SSL Verschlüsselung

Nun müssen wir deine Website noch ins Internet bringen. Zuerst einmal verschlüsseln wir dazu deine Domain. Das machst du in deinem Hetzner-Account. Du gehst dort zur Domain (nicht zum Account). Auf Einstellungen, ganz unten SSL. Dann Basic Zertifikat auswählen. Länge des Schlüssels nicht ändern. Rechts daneben den Pfeil zum Laden anklicken. Das braucht eine gute Minute. Dann darunter: HTTPS-Weiterleitung auf ein schieben.

Wichtig: Dieser Schritt funktioniert erst, wenn deine Domain erreichbar ist. Das ist meist ca. 1-2 Stunden nach der Bestellung der Fall.

Update: Wenn du vorher deine Domain irgendwo anders hattest und diese Domain umziehst, musst du zusätzlich noch den SSL-Manager öffnen und die Domain korrekt zuweisen. Wenn du die Domain aber neu kaufst, sollte alles automatisch funktionieren.

Anschließend kannst du dir unter E-Mail noch direkt eine Mailadresse oder Weiterleitung zu deiner Domain anlegen.

5. Publii mit Webspace verbinden

Bei Hetzner findest du dann auch die Zugangsdaten, die wir jetzt für Publii zur Verbindung der erstellten Inhalte auf deinem Desktop mit dem Webspace brauchen. Dazu gehst du zum Account (also nicht mehr Domain). Du kannst da direkt in der Kopfzeile in den Breadcrumbs eins weiter vorne anklicken.

Die Zugangsdaten findest du dann unter Einstellungen und Logindaten. Diese Sachen musst du dann bei Publii eingeben:

  • Dazu gehst du zu Server.
  • Dann SFTP auswählen.
  • Die Website-URL ist deine Domain.
  • Port müsste bei 22 sein. Also nicht ändern.
  • Server von Hetzner reinkopieren (z.B. wwwxxx.your-server.de oder etwas ähnliches).
  • Ebenso Loginname als Username und das Passwort.
  • ‚Always ask for password‘ kannst du ausgestellt lassen, wenn du auf deinem eigenen Gerät arbeitest.
  • Dann bei remote path eintragen: public_html/
  • Dann unten Test Connection.

Wenn kein Fehler kommt: Save Settings.

Jetzt fehlt dann nur noch die Übertragung. Dafür kannst du links unten ‚Sync your Website‘ wählen. Alles wird hochgeladen – und wenn du jetzt deine Website-Adresse im Browser öffnest, stehen deine Inhalte online. Du kannst jederzeit ändern/ ergänzen und dann einfach immer wieder syncen. Manchmal sind Dateien noch im Cache des Browsers und du siehst nicht direkt Änderungen.

Geschafft! 🎉

Ich wünsche dir viel Freude mit deiner Website. Melde dich gerne, wenn du nicht weiter kommst!

Beitrag weiternutzen und teilen

Dieser Beitrag steht unter der Lizenz CC BY 4.0 und kann somit gerne offen weitergenutzt und geteilt werden. Hier kannst du dir den Beitragslink und/oder den Lizenzhinweis kopieren. Wenn du den Beitragslink in das Suchfeld im Fediverse (z.B. bei Mastodon) eingibst, wird er dir dort angezeigt und du kannst ihn kommentieren.

Link kopieren Lizenz kopieren #DigitaleMündigkeit